General Definition of Work
The Auditor/Accountant, under general supervision performs financial audits of schools and departments, inventory audits of warehouses and assists with additional accounting functions as needed.

Essential Functions
• Adhere to all state, federal, and local laws, policies, and procedures
• Perform allotted schedule of school financial audits and ensure that district policies and procedures are being adhered to consistently as applicable per the audit program
• Implement audit program conducting field tests of various financial areas to ensure internal controls exist and are being applied to audited areas as deemed appropriate
• Draft and share audit findings with school principal and treasurer, and provide recommendations to correct areas of non-compliance
• Compile audit results in comprehensive audit binder to document results of audits. Submit compiled audit binders for quality control review
• Transmit final audit letter documenting significant audit findings to school principals and treasurers once review has been completed
• Assist with test counts of warehouses inventory, looping in warehouse or inventory manager on any discrepancies
• Field questions from school treasurers in reference to accounting software utilized by schools. Provide additional support relating to district policies and procedures as needed
• Assist, as needed, with preparation of Comprehensive Annual Financial Report (CAFR)
• Performs related duties as assigned Education and Experience
